Principal Duties and Responsibilities:
- Client Service: Deliver outstanding client service to both internal and external clients.
- Client Interaction: Assist in managing client emails and phone calls, as appropriate.
- Administrative Support: Assist with email management via MS Outlook. Assist with arranging appointments and meetings (including virtual platforms such as Zoom and MS Teams).
- Database Management: Assist with updating relevant information in project tracking database.
- Digital Asset Production: Assist with building and optimizing logos for client logo database and tracking completion of logos. Assist with retouching and optimizing headshots for headshot database.
- Production Design: Create and revise documents using Adobe Creative Suite (InDesign, Illustrator, Photoshop, Dreamweaver, After Effects) PowerPoint, MS Word and Visio.

Work Schedule and Onboarding Details.
Standard working hours for this non-exempt role are from 9:30 AM to 5:30 PM, Monday through Friday. During the initial training and onboarding phase, GSAs will be required to be onsite five days a week. Following the successful completion of the onboarding phase, GSAs will transition to a hybrid schedule, consisting of three to four days onsite with the remaining days remote, subject to operational workflow needs.
